HOUSTON – HCU men's basketball will aim to break a five-game losing skid against Southwestern Adventist in a Sunday matinee matchup in Sharp Gym with tip-off set for 2:00 p.m. Houston Christian University (HCU), formerly Houston Baptist University (HBU), underwent a name change in September 2022.
The Huskies (1-7) boast three starters averaging better than 10 points per game led by junior
Brycen Long at 14.5 ppg. Long leads the Southland Conference with 24 made threes this season, a total that ranks 30
th in the nation. He now has 111 made threes in his career, good for 13
th on the program's all-time list and putting him 26 away from the top-ten.
Senior center
Bonke Maring is shooting 61.1 percent (44-of-72) from the field for the best mark in the league and is averaging 12.5 ppg. Fellow senior
Maks Klanjscek is the third Husky after double-figures, scoring 10.6 ppg. A pair of true freshman guards,
Pierce Bazil and
Andrew King, lead the team in assists with a combined 6.9 assists per game.
As a team, HCU ranks in the top-40 nationally in three-point percentage, connecting on 38.7 percent (74-of-191) from behind the arc.
Southwestern Adventist (0-5) is led in scoring by sophomore guard Alain Aviles with 13.5 ppg while fellow guard Ephraim Viadex is second with 12 ppg. Sophomore center Byron Fields is the Knights' top rebounded, pulling down seven rebounds per game while 5-10 guard Justin Lamb is second with 6.8 rpg.
HCU defeated the Knights 100-62 last season with
Deshon Proctor scoring 16 with 11 rebounds and Long adding 15 off the bench.
Sam Hofman scored 11 for the Huskies. HCU dominated the glass in that matchup, pulling down 60 rebounds to SWAU's 24.
